Because they have been getting started in the summer of 2008, the founders needed a way to elevate funds. They bought a bunch of cereal and designed Distinctive edition election-themed bins, released that fall—Obama O’s and Cap’n McCain’s, which they marketed at Conference functions for $40 a box. They offered five hundred containers of each and every cereal, helping them to raise about $30k for Airbed & Breakfast.
